摘要
Investigation of HTSC thermal stability in air shows that the samples, containing 75% of 2223 phase and 25% of 2212 phase, at 800-degrees-C does not change phase ratio and transition parameters. At lower annealing temperature (700-degrees or 750-degrees-C) there appear "tail" on resistive curve and traces of new phases. Subsequant annealing of these samples at 800-degrees-C restores initial parameters. The highest oxygen nonstoichiometry index-delta of Pb-containing 2223 phase equal to 0.20 +/- 0.01 is reached at 750-degrees-C, i.e. at lower boundary of highest homologue thermal stability.
